Countries with more Bondo in the world

  1. Democratic Republic of the Congo Democratic Republic of the Congo (52217)
  2. Angola Angola (12633)
  3. Liberia Liberia (7291)
  4. Malawi Malawi (1619)
  5. Kenya Kenya (1180)
  6. Tanzania Tanzania (784)
  7. Cameroon Cameroon (474)
  8. Denmark Denmark (233)
  9. Zimbabwe Zimbabwe (214)
  10. United States United States (153)
  11. Indonesia Indonesia (132)
  12. France France (127)
  13. Papua New Guinea Papua New Guinea (87)
  14. Zambia Zambia (76)
  15. Uganda Uganda (71)
  16. South Africa South Africa (67)
  17. Belgium Belgium (44)
  18. Portugal Portugal (38)
  19. England England (37)
  20. Ivory Coast Ivory Coast (23)
  21. Ireland Ireland (21)
  22. Nigeria Nigeria (18)
  23. Philippines Philippines (15)
  24. India India (13)
  25. Burkina Faso Burkina Faso (12)
  26. Canada Canada (12)
  27. Central African Republic Central African Republic (9)
  28. Russia Russia (9)
  29. Egypt Egypt (9)
  30. Israel Israel (7)
  31. Pakistan Pakistan (7)
  32. United Arab Emirates United Arab Emirates (6)
  33. Georgia Georgia (6)
  34. Germany Germany (5)
  35. Brazil Brazil (4)
  36. Botswana Botswana (4)
  37. Gabon Gabon (4)
  38. Italy Italy (3)
  39. Niger Niger (2)
  40. Norway Norway (2)
  41. Venezuela Venezuela (1)
  42. Albania Albania (1)
  43. Kuwait Kuwait (1)
  44. Lebanon Lebanon (1)
  45. Bangladesh Bangladesh (1)
  46. Mozambique Mozambique (1)
  47. Burundi Burundi (1)
  48. Namibia Namibia (1)
  49. Benin Benin (1)
  50. Netherlands Netherlands (1)
  51. New Zealand New Zealand (1)
  52. Republic of the Congo Republic of the Congo (1)
  53. Switzerland Switzerland (1)
  54. Poland Poland (1)
  55. Colombia Colombia (1)
  56. Rwanda Rwanda (1)
  57. Saudi Arabia Saudi Arabia (1)
  58. Algeria Algeria (1)
  59. Sudan Sudan (1)
  60. Singapore Singapore (1)
  61. Senegal Senegal (1)
  62. Somalia Somalia (1)
  63. Chad Chad (1)
  64. Ghana Ghana (1)
